正文
kettle无法连接mysql数据库连接,kettle 连接数据库
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
如何加大kettle并行数量增大导致断开数据库连接
1、将下载的mysql jdbc包解压,取出mysql-connector-java.jar包(这里驱动包有版本号)。放入kettle的lib目录下面。3 重新启动kettle。可以测试连接,此时连接已经连上。
2、修改方式,自行百度 例如wait_timeout是8小时,只需把调度周期设为8小时即可 在kettle4测试不通过,在kettle7测试通过。
3、解决:采用kettle0.1,配置hadoop 20的相关插件后,是可以了。
kettle无法连接远程资源库(mysql)
将对应的mysql驱动包(mysql-connector-java-15-bin.jar)放到下kettle的目录:data-integration\libext\JDBC下。再次进行连接测试通过。
如果 你的在设计 一个transformation,比如 表输出,主机名称栏不要用主机名,用IP地址 来代替。因为在本地测试连接时,输主机名是可以的,2 肯定成立。也许能解决,哈哈。。
kettle作业在运行一段时间后会报错,原因是mysql会默认每8小时回收一次无用连接。错误日志如下:然后你的作业就失败了,必须重新启动kettle才能解决。经过多次排查,最终解决。
检查MySQL的驱动包是否引入到kettle的lib文件夹里面,检查数据源配置信息,如IP,端口,库名,账号密码等是否正确,测试连接看看提示信息。
将对应的mysql驱动包(mysql-connector-java-15-bin.jar)放到下kettle的目录:data-integration\libext\JDBC下。
kettle4.4连接mysql数据库没成功,提示org.gjt.mm.mysql.Driver找不到...
1、com.mysql.jdbc.Driver 把数据库驱动字符串改成这样 在确认一次 你的工程下的lib文件夹下 有没有mysql的数据库驱动 两个部分都满足了 程序没问题了。
2、如果 你的在设计 一个transformation,比如 表输出,主机名称栏不要用主机名,用IP地址 来代替。因为在本地测试连接时,输主机名是可以的,2 肯定成立。也许能解决,哈哈。。
3、将对应的mysql驱动包(mysql-connector-java-15-bin.jar)放到下kettle的目录:data-integration\libext\JDBC下。
4、(当然这个包很老了,但是还是能够发挥作用)里面也有com.mysql.jdbc 但是还是报错,最后改成org.gjt.mm.mysql(也是在驱动包里面的)就可以了。。不过我是在netbeans下做的。
5、php。打开数据库配置文件,并修改三个重要配置。在控制器文件中,导入Db类。使用Db类的静态方法query 从数据库中查询一条内容,并保存查询结果。打印保存的结果。就可以连接数据库了。
kettle作业连接mysql资源库8小时后报错
1、检查MySQL的驱动包是否引入到kettle的lib文件夹里面,检查数据源配置信息,如IP,端口,库名,账号密码等是否正确,测试连接看看提示信息。
2、将对应的mysql驱动包(mysql-connector-java-15-bin.jar)放到下kettle的目录:data-integration\libext\JDBC下。
3、将对应的mysql驱动包(mysql-connector-java-15-bin.jar)放到下kettle的目录:data-integration\libext\JDBC下。再次进行连接测试通过。
4、版本不一致。kettle连接数据库报错java.lang.ClassCastException:java.math.Biglnteger是因为驱动包版本不一致,将数据库的版本升级至为0.11即可。
5、您好,ORA-00600错误通常是由于Oracle数据库连接问题引起的。您可以尝试以下方法解决此问题:检查您的Oracle数据库连接是否正确配置。检查您的Oracle数据库是否正在运行。检查您的Oracle数据库是否有足够的内存和磁盘空间。
关于kettle无法连接mysql数据库连接和kettle 连接数据库的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。